Python Build Environment Variables Investigation

This skill helps you discover all environment variables that can be set when building Python wheels for a project. It performs a comprehensive analysis of build configuration files to identify customizable environment variables used during the wheel building process.

Instructions

When a user asks about environment variables for building Python wheels, investigating build configuration, or understanding build customization options:

  1. Run the Environment Variables Investigation Script:

    ./scripts/env_finder.py [project_path]
    
  2. Analyze and present the findings focusing on:

    Build Configuration Variables

    • Setup.py Variables: Environment variables used in setup.py for customizing builds
    • CMake Variables: Variables defined in CMakeLists.txt and related files
    • Build Tool Variables: Variables used by setuptools, distutils, or other build systems
    • Compiler Variables: Variables affecting compilation (CC, CXX, CFLAGS, etc.)

    Variable Categories

    Compiler and Linker Variables

    • CC, CXX - Compiler selection
    • CFLAGS, CXXFLAGS - Compilation flags
    • LDFLAGS - Linker flags
    • LIBS - Additional libraries

    Path Configuration Variables

    • PREFIX - Installation prefix
    • LIBRARY_PATH - Library search paths
    • INCLUDE_PATH - Header file paths
    • PKG_CONFIG_PATH - pkg-config search paths

    Feature Control Variables

    • ENABLE_* - Feature enable/disable flags
    • WITH_* - Optional component inclusion
    • USE_* - Build option selection
    • DISABLE_* - Feature disable flags

    Python-Specific Variables

    • PYTHON_INCLUDE_DIR - Python headers location
    • PYTHON_LIBRARY - Python library path
    • SETUPTOOLS_* - Setuptools configuration
    • PIP_* - pip-related build variables
